Thanks V2! I wouldn't recommend letting them go all the way dead more than once to figure out how long one will last you in a situation where charging isn't an option. What I usually do is use one and throw the other on the charger until it's green, and as soon as I notice it's green I take it off and let it sit until I notice a bit of a difference in flavor / throat hit on the one I'm using. Then that one hits the charger until it's topped off and I use the other. Vicious circle really, but if I take a fresh one to work with me it will last until I get home, put the low battery from the morning on the charger (I don't like to leave them charging when I'm out), and give me an hour or two of vape time before the other is ready to come off with quite a bit of charge to spare. I never really have to worry about a backup.

One thing I wouldn't do is leave it on the charger for extended periods of time while the green charged indicator is solid. There's always a chance for failure, and while the battery should be fine to sit on the charger for days (in theory), there have been stories of the things turning into flame-spouting rockets because protection / regulation failed while on the charger and the cell got overloaded.
